Expect moving costs from Aurora to San Jose to vary based on the size of your household. Small moves generally range from $1,342 to $1,388, medium moves from $1,543 to $1,596, and large moves from $1,745 to $1,804. Prices fluctuate due to distance, volume of belongings, packing needs, and seasonal demand. Choosing full service or partial service options also impacts the final cost.

Moving costs for this interstate route generally range from about $1,342 to $1,804 depending on the size of your move and services selected. Small moves are on the lower end, while large household moves with additional services cost more.
Standard and expedited delivery options typically take around 2 days for this 935-mile interstate move. Exact timing can vary based on the moving company’s schedule and route conditions.
The most affordable option usually involves a smaller shipment with self-packing and flexible delivery dates. Choosing a basic long distance moving service without extra packing or storage reduces costs.
Booking several weeks in advance is recommended to secure better pricing and availability. Last-minute bookings or peak season moves often come with higher rates.
Yes, moving companies operating between Colorado and California must be licensed interstate movers, ensuring compliance with federal regulations and protection for your belongings.
